From caring for the tiniest bulb to fundamental issues of water conservation and garden sustainability, this beautifully illustrated guide explores how to create, enjoy, and maintain a garden. Practical, technique-driven sections--addressing how to cultivate and care for plants and fruit frees, pave a path, create nutrient-rich compost, or design a kitchen garden--are interspersed with historical tidbits, recipes, and luscious photographs. Readers are also taken on a journey to notable gardens throughout the world, including the Asticou Azalea Garden in Maine, Coton Manor in Northampshire, and the Jardin des Paradis in France.
